OPERATING THE CONTINUOUS PLAYBACK
MODE
4-6-1. Entering the Continuous Playback Mode
1. Set the disc in the unit. (Whichever recordable discs or discs
for playback only are available.)
2. Turning the SELECTOR knob and display "CPLAY MODE".
3. Press the ENTER/YES button to change the display to
"CPLAY MID".
4. When access completes, the display changes to
"C1=
AD=
".
Note: The numbers " " displayed show you error rates and ADER.
4-6-2. Changing the Parts to be Played-back
1. Press the ENTER/YES button during continuous playback to
change the display as below.
CPLAY MID
CPLAY OUT
2. When access completes, the display changes to
"C1=
AD=
".
Note: The numbers " " displayed show you error rates and ADER.
4-6-3. Ending the Continuous Playback Mode
1. Press the EDIT/NO button. The display will change to
"CPLAY MODE".
2. Press the § EJECT button and remove the disc.
Notes:
1. The playback start address for IN, MID, and OUT are as fol-
lows.
IN
: 40h cluster
MID : 300h cluster
OUT : 700h cluster
In case you want to display the address of the playback posi-
tion on the display, press the DISPLAY/CHARACTER but-
ton and display "CPLAY (
2. The EDIT/NO button can be used to stop playing anytime.
CPLAY IN
)".

4-7. OPERATING THE CONTINUOUS RECORDING
MODE
4-7-1. Entering the Continuous Recording Mode
1. Set the MO disc in the unit. (Refer to note 3.)
2. Turning the SELECTOR knob and display "CREC MODE".
3. Press the ENTER/YES button to change the display to "CREC
MID".
4. When access completes, the display changes to "CREC (
and
REC
lights up.
Note: The numbers " " displayed shows you the recording posi-
tion address.
4-7-2. Changing the Parts to be Recorded
1. When the ENTER/YES button is pressed during continuous
recording, the display changes as below. (
turns off during change-over of display.)
CREC MID
CREC OUT
2. When access completes, the display changes to "CREC (
and
REC
lights up.
Note: The numbers " " displayed shows you the recording posi-
tion address.
4-7-3. Ending the Continuous Recording Mode
1. Press the EDIT/NO button. The display will change to "CREC
REC
MODE" and
goes off.
2. Press the § EJECT button and remove the disc.
Notes:
1. The recording start address for IN, MID, and OUT are as fol-
lows.
IN
: 40h cluster
MID : 300h cluster
OUT : 700h cluster
2. The EDIT/NO button can be used to stop recording anytime.
3. During the test mode, the erasing-protection tab will not be
detected. Therefore be careful not to set the continuous re-
cording mode when a disc not to be erased is set in the unit.
4. Do not perform continuous recording for long periods of time
above 5 minutes.
5. During continuous recording, be careful not to apply vibra-
tion.
